Crossfire Ministries
is a ministry of First Church to at-risk children, who
live in our surrounding neighborhood and community.
Many of the children who participate in the Crossfire
program do not regularly have nutritious, hot meals at
home or have safe environments to learn and to play
when they are away from school. Our Crossfire
volunteers provide transportation for their students,
feed them, play with them, love on them and share with
them the love of Jesus Christ. The theme for
Crossfire is “Live Out Loud,” and the volunteers (made
up almost entirely of First Church members) work
tirelessly to not only live their faith “out loud,”
but to help the children under their care to learn to
do the same.
